Today's nonprofit managers must juggle many responsibilities, including meeting the changing needs of the community, securing the funding to make ends meet, and responding to the often conflicting demands of founders, clientele, staff, and trustees. This core volume in the widely respected Mission-Based Management Series, provides a comprehensive plan for successfully meeting all of these challenges, all the while, remaining true to the overall mission of the organization.
Mission-Based Management Leading Your Not-For-Profit Into the 21st Century Mission-Based Management is the definitive text for the leaders of not-for-profit organizations. You will learn: Nine key characteristics of a successful not-for-profit Six basic tenets of successfully managing staff Nine policy controls that let you sleep at night Five keys to recruiting and retaining the board members you want Seven future trends sure to impact not-for-profits over the coming years Five characteristics an organization must have to be financially empowered Ten biggest mistakes not-for-profits make in planning and much, much more in 15 jampacked chapters. Peter C. Brinckerhoff, noted consultant to not-for-profits, not only tells how and why — he also gives examples and practical hands-on techniques you can use immediately.
